The cost of six hens and one duck at the university poultry farm is GH₵40. While four hens and three ducks cost GH₵36. What is the cost of each type of bird?
Answer:
Step-by-step explanation:
Let's call hens h and ducks d. The first algebraic equation says that 6 hens (6h) plus (+) 1 duck (1d) cost (=) 40.
The second algebraic equations says that 4 hens (4h) plus (+) 3 ducks (3d) cost (=) 36.
The system is
6h + 1d = 40
4h + 3d = 36
The best way to go about this is to solve it by substitution since we have a 1d in the first equation. We will solve that equation for d since that makes the most sense algebraically. Doing that,
1d = 40 - 6h.
Now that we know what d equals, we can sub it into the second equation where we see a d. In order,
4h + 3d = 36 becomes
4h + 3(40 - 6h) = 36 and then simplify. By substituting into the second equation we eliminated one of the variables. You can only have 1 unknown in a single equation, and now we do!
4h + 120 - 18h = 36 and
-14h = -84 so
h = 6.
That means that each hen costs $6. Since the cost of a duck is found in the bold print equation above, we will sub in a 6 for h to solve for d:
1d = 40 - 6(6) and
d = 40 - 36 so
d = 4.
That means that each duck costs $4.

Which equation describes a parabola that opens left or right and whose
vertex is at the point (h, v)?
A. y = a(x - 1)2 + 1
B. x = aly - y)2 + h
C. x = aly - h)2 + V
O D. y = a(x - h)2 + V
Answer:
B. x = a(y - v)^2 + h
Step-by-step explanation:
The basic equation is ...
x = f(y)
x = y^2
To translate the vertex from (0, 0) to (h, v), we replace x with (x-h) and y with (y-v). Now, we have ...
x -h = (y -v)^2
To scale the graph horizontally by a factor of "a", we multiply the right side by "a":
x -h = a(y -v)^2
Adding h gives the form you want to compare to the answer list:
x = a(y -v)^2 +h
_____
The attachment shows an example for (h, v) = (4, 3).

Consider the following polynomial.
X^3 -6x^2 + 49x -294
Write the equivalent factored form of the polynomial. Fill in the expression with the values of a, b and where a is an integer and band
care complex numbers.
Answer:
The equivalent factored form of this equation is (x² + 49)(x - 6)
Step-by-step explanation:
x³ - 6x² + 49x - 294
First, group the first and second terms together and group the last two terms together.
(x³ - 6x²) + (49x - 294)
Find the greatest common factor of both parentheses and factor them.
x²(x - 6) + 49(x - 6)
Now, since the two terms in the parentheses are the same, then we have factored the equation correctly.
So, the factored form of the equation is (x² + 49)(x - 6)

The hypotenuse and a leg of a particular right triangle are $\sqrt{97}$ inches and 4 inches, respectively. The area of this triangle is what common fraction of a square foot?
Answer: 1/8
Step-by-step explanation:
Hypotenuse = √97
One leg = 4
By Pythagoras theorem, second leg² = (√97)² - 4²
= 97 - 16 = 81
So second leg = 9
Area of triangle = 4 x 9 / 2 = 18 sq inch
One sq foot = 144 sq inch
So required fraction = 18/144 = 1/8
